Things That Will Make Your Business Headshots Complete

Have you ever thought why some photos look so impressive while others are so pale and fake? It’s all about the details. The beautiful photos are the result of all complex and smart work. A professional photographer, a stylist and a thoroughly created background are the most important components of the photo session.

Talking about the background, we need to emphasize the small things that create an atmosphere. They require special attention. Considering the image you would like to get, there are different accessories that will contribute to it.

Another reason for having well-prepared props is comfort. If you are not used to professional photo shoots, the whole process can be a bit stressful for you. Props will help you to choose the pose and stop thinking about the right place for your hands. The things you really use for your work may be especially helpful for such purposes.

Here are some tips for making your Business Headshots complete:

Add a Desk

This is probably the first thing that comes to your mind when you think about it business headshots. A good desk is necessary, regardless of your profession. Pay attention to its design, as it’s about to match your style. You may consider a classic option or a creative one. Don’t forget to add an armchair. Put these pieces together and it will become a core of your background.

Add Stationery

A beautiful notebook, a sophisticated pen, or a set of colorful tip markers can be used as accents. If you would like to minimize the small accents in the photo, use neutral stationery. It will add the necessary volume, so the background will not look too blank. Yet there will be no visual distractions.

Add some Figurines

Figurines are not the most necessary component for the background of business headshots. Yet they are good if you want to emphasize your professional area. Thus, lawyers can choose a figurine of Themis. Newton’s cradle is usually associated with psychological counseling. Choreographers may add a figurine of a ballet dancer.

Add a Desk lamp

Consider adding a stylish desk lamp into the photo background. It really doesn’t matter if you are going to use it during the shooting or not. This beautiful piece creates an atmosphere of work and makes the whole scenery look so real. Besides, it may be an extra source of light. But you’d better check it with your photographer.

Add a Laptop

Most likely you have a laptop, which helps you to get the job done. You can bring your own appliance to the photo session. Using your laptop will add more comfort to the process, allowing you to be yourself. It will give that “business” ambiance you are looking to create. Choose the right location

The location you choose for your photoshoot can play a big role in the overall look and feel of your headshots. Choose a location that is professional and visually appealing, such as a well-lit studio or an outdoor location with a nice background.

dress appropriately

Your attire can make a big difference in how you are perceived in your headshots. Dress in a way that is professional and reflects your personal style while also being appropriate for your industry. Here are some tips for what to wear for a business headshot.

Pose naturally

It’s important to pose in a way that feels natural and comfortable to you. Your photographer can guide you in finding the right poses that will help bring out your personality and confidence.

Don’t forget about retouching

While it’s important to present a natural and authentic image in your headshots, a little bit of retouching can go a long way in enhancing your photos. Your photographer can remove blemishes, adjust the color and brightness, and make other small tweaks to make your headshots look their best.
